Japan International Cooperation Agency (JICA), in partnership with the Ministry of Science, Technology and Innovation and The Innovation Village, has awarded three Ugandan Start-ups for their innovative business models and technologies in response to changes in social and economic activity following the arrival of the COVID-19 pandemic.  The startups won the Uganda Chapter of the “NINJA Business Plan Competition, dubbed the NINJA COVID-19 Response and Recovery Business Challenge”.   While commenting on the recognition of the Start-ups, The Innovation Village Team Lead Japheth Kawanguzi said the emergence of Uganda’s M-Scan, a developer of low-cost mobile ultra-sound devices, as the best…
